5
Newspaper Source: South China Morning Post
Publication Date: 1923-11-12
Summary:

Rich Men's Wives,' the illuminating film presented for the first time at the Coronet last night, is a vivid revelation of the hectic life of New York society. The details of two notorious divorce cases in New York inspired the plot of the play. Film synopsis included.
